> Subject: [PATCH 22.11] common/cnxk: fix IPv6 extension header parsing
>
> From: Satheesh Paul <psatheesh@marvell.com>
>
> [ upstream commit 0a6a4437631de7b41352326123b366f31cf7d0f7 ]
>
> RTE_FLOW_ITEM_TYPE_IPV6_EXT and
> RTE_FLOW_ITEM_TYPE_IPV6_FRAG_EXT pattern items can be specified
> following a RTE_FLOW_ITEM_TYPE_IPV6.
> Modified layer C parsing logic to handle this.
>
> Fixes: a800675b06f9 ("net/cnxk: support IPv6 fragment flow pattern item")
>
> Signed-off-by: Satheesh Paul <psatheesh@marvell.com>
> ---
> drivers/common/cnxk/roc_npc.h | 11 +++
> drivers/common/cnxk/roc_npc_parse.c | 143 +++++++++++++++++++++++-----
> 2 files changed, 130 insertions(+), 24 deletions(-)

> diff --git a/drivers/common/cnxk/roc_npc.h
> b/drivers/common/cnxk/roc_npc.h index 1b4e5521cb..60f9c5d634 100644
> --- a/drivers/common/cnxk/roc_npc.h
> +++ b/drivers/common/cnxk/roc_npc.h
> @@ -123,6 +123,17 @@ struct roc_ipv6_hdr {
> uint8_t dst_addr[16]; /**< IP address of destination host(s). */ }
> __plt_packed;
>
> +struct roc_ipv6_fragment_ext {
> + uint8_t next_header; /**< Next header type */
> + uint8_t reserved; /**< Reserved */
> + uint16_t frag_data; /**< All fragmentation data */
> + uint32_t id; /**< Packet ID */
> +} __plt_packed;
> +
> +struct roc_flow_item_ipv6_ext {
> + uint8_t next_hdr; /**< Next header. */ };
> +
> struct roc_npc_flow_item_ipv6 {
> struct roc_ipv6_hdr hdr; /**< IPv6 header definition. */
> uint32_t has_hop_ext : 1;
> diff --git a/drivers/common/cnxk/roc_npc_parse.c
> b/drivers/common/cnxk/roc_npc_parse.c
> index 670f920117..6d834aae11 100644
> --- a/drivers/common/cnxk/roc_npc_parse.c
> +++ b/drivers/common/cnxk/roc_npc_parse.c
> @@ -662,10 +662,125 @@ npc_handle_ipv6ext_attr(const struct
> roc_npc_flow_item_ipv6 *ipv6_spec,
> return 0;
> }
>
> +static int
> +npc_process_ipv6_item(struct npc_parse_state *pst) {
> + uint8_t ipv6_hdr_mask[sizeof(struct roc_ipv6_hdr) + sizeof(struct
> roc_ipv6_fragment_ext)];
> + uint8_t ipv6_hdr_buf[sizeof(struct roc_ipv6_hdr) + sizeof(struct
> roc_ipv6_fragment_ext)];
> + const struct roc_npc_flow_item_ipv6 *ipv6_spec, *ipv6_mask;
> + const struct roc_npc_item_info *pattern = pst->pattern;
> + int offset = 0, rc = 0, lid, item_count = 0;
> + struct npc_parse_item_info parse_info;
> + char hw_mask[NPC_MAX_EXTRACT_HW_LEN];
> + uint8_t flags = 0, ltype;
> +
> + memset(ipv6_hdr_buf, 0, sizeof(ipv6_hdr_buf));
> + memset(ipv6_hdr_mask, 0, sizeof(ipv6_hdr_mask));
> +
> + ipv6_spec = pst->pattern->spec;
> + ipv6_mask = pst->pattern->mask;
> +
> + parse_info.def_mask = NULL;
> + parse_info.spec = ipv6_hdr_buf;
> + parse_info.mask = ipv6_hdr_mask;
> + parse_info.def_mask = NULL;
> + parse_info.hw_hdr_len = 0;
> + parse_info.len = sizeof(ipv6_spec->hdr);
> +
> + pst->set_ipv6ext_ltype_mask = true;
> +
> + lid = NPC_LID_LC;
> + ltype = NPC_LT_LC_IP6;
> +
> + if (pattern->type == ROC_NPC_ITEM_TYPE_IPV6) {
> + item_count++;
> + if (ipv6_spec) {
> + memcpy(ipv6_hdr_buf, &ipv6_spec->hdr,
> sizeof(struct roc_ipv6_hdr));
> + rc = npc_handle_ipv6ext_attr(ipv6_spec, pst, &flags);
> + if (rc)
> + return rc;
> + }
> + if (ipv6_mask)
> + memcpy(ipv6_hdr_mask, &ipv6_mask->hdr,
> sizeof(struct roc_ipv6_hdr));
> + }
> +
> + offset = sizeof(struct roc_ipv6_hdr);
> +
> + while (pattern->type != ROC_NPC_ITEM_TYPE_END) {
> + /* Don't support ranges */
> + if (pattern->last != NULL)
> + return NPC_ERR_INVALID_RANGE;
> +
> + /* If spec is NULL, both mask and last must be NULL, this
> + * makes it to match ANY value (eq to mask = 0).
> + * Setting either mask or last without spec is
> + * an error
> + */
> + if (pattern->spec == NULL) {
> + if (pattern->last != NULL && pattern->mask != NULL)
> + return NPC_ERR_INVALID_SPEC;
> + }
> + /* Either one ROC_NPC_ITEM_TYPE_IPV6_EXT or
> + * one ROC_NPC_ITEM_TYPE_IPV6_FRAG_EXT is supported
> + * following an ROC_NPC_ITEM_TYPE_IPV6 item.
> + */
> + if (pattern->type == ROC_NPC_ITEM_TYPE_IPV6_EXT) {
> + item_count++;
> + ltype = NPC_LT_LC_IP6_EXT;
> + parse_info.len =
> + sizeof(struct roc_ipv6_hdr) + sizeof(struct
> roc_flow_item_ipv6_ext);
> + if (pattern->spec)
> + memcpy(ipv6_hdr_buf + offset, pattern->spec,
> + sizeof(struct roc_flow_item_ipv6_ext));
> + if (pattern->mask)
> + memcpy(ipv6_hdr_mask + offset, pattern-
> >mask,
> + sizeof(struct roc_flow_item_ipv6_ext));
> + break;
> + } else if (pattern->type ==
> ROC_NPC_ITEM_TYPE_IPV6_FRAG_EXT) {
> + item_count++;
> + ltype = NPC_LT_LC_IP6_EXT;
> + flags = NPC_F_LC_U_IP6_FRAG;
> + parse_info.len =
> + sizeof(struct roc_ipv6_hdr) + sizeof(struct
> roc_ipv6_fragment_ext);
> + if (pattern->spec)
> + memcpy(ipv6_hdr_buf + offset, pattern->spec,
> + sizeof(struct roc_ipv6_fragment_ext));
> + if (pattern->mask)
> + memcpy(ipv6_hdr_mask + offset, pattern-
> >mask,
> + sizeof(struct roc_ipv6_fragment_ext));
> +
> + break;
> + }
> +
> + pattern++;
> + pattern = npc_parse_skip_void_and_any_items(pattern);
> + }
> +
> + memset(hw_mask, 0, sizeof(hw_mask));
> +
> + parse_info.hw_mask = &hw_mask;
> + npc_get_hw_supp_mask(pst, &parse_info, lid, ltype);
> +
> + rc = npc_mask_is_supported(parse_info.mask, parse_info.hw_mask,
> parse_info.len);
> + if (!rc)
> + return NPC_ERR_INVALID_MASK;
> +
> + rc = npc_update_parse_state(pst, &parse_info, lid, ltype, flags);
> + if (rc)
> + return rc;
> +
> + /* npc_update_parse_state() increments pattern once.
> + * Check if additional increment is required.
> + */
> + if (item_count == 2)
> + pst->pattern++;
> +
> + return 0;
> +}
> +
> int
> npc_parse_lc(struct npc_parse_state *pst) {
> - const struct roc_npc_flow_item_ipv6 *ipv6_spec;
> const struct roc_npc_flow_item_raw *raw_spec;
> uint8_t raw_spec_buf[NPC_MAX_RAW_ITEM_LEN];
> uint8_t raw_mask_buf[NPC_MAX_RAW_ITEM_LEN];
> @@ -690,32 +805,12 @@ npc_parse_lc(struct npc_parse_state *pst)
> info.len = pst->pattern->size;
> break;
> case ROC_NPC_ITEM_TYPE_IPV6:
> - ipv6_spec = pst->pattern->spec;
> - lid = NPC_LID_LC;
> - lt = NPC_LT_LC_IP6;
> - if (ipv6_spec) {
> - rc = npc_handle_ipv6ext_attr(ipv6_spec, pst, &flags);
> - if (rc)
> - return rc;
> - }
> - info.len = sizeof(ipv6_spec->hdr);
> - break;
> - case ROC_NPC_ITEM_TYPE_ARP_ETH_IPV4:
> - lt = NPC_LT_LC_ARP;
> - info.len = pst->pattern->size;
> - break;
> case ROC_NPC_ITEM_TYPE_IPV6_EXT:
> - lid = NPC_LID_LC;
> - lt = NPC_LT_LC_IP6_EXT;
> - info.len = pst->pattern->size;
> - info.hw_hdr_len = 40;
> - break;
> case ROC_NPC_ITEM_TYPE_IPV6_FRAG_EXT:
> - lid = NPC_LID_LC;
> - lt = NPC_LT_LC_IP6_EXT;
> - flags = NPC_F_LC_U_IP6_FRAG;
> + return npc_process_ipv6_item(pst);
> + case ROC_NPC_ITEM_TYPE_ARP_ETH_IPV4:
> + lt = NPC_LT_LC_ARP;
> info.len = pst->pattern->size;
> - info.hw_hdr_len = 40;
> break;
> case ROC_NPC_ITEM_TYPE_L3_CUSTOM:
> lt = NPC_LT_LC_CUSTOM0;
